Does The Devereux Foundation sponsor H-1B visas and green cards?
Yes. The Devereux Foundation has filed 166 H-1B Labor Condition Applications with the U.S. Department of Labor since FY2023. 99.4% of those filings were certified. The median annual wage across those filings is $45,282. They have also filed 89 PERM (green-card) applications over the same period, with a 67.4% certification rate.

Top H-1B occupations at The Devereux Foundation
The Standard Occupational Classification (SOC) codes The Devereux Foundation most frequently files H-1Bs for, based on the most recent fiscal year of DOL data.
| Occupation | Filings | Median wage |
|---|---|---|
| Rehabilitation Counselors SOC 21-1015.00 | 23 | $40,664 |
| Social and Community Service Managers SOC 11-9151.00 | 8 | $55,182 |
| Child, Family, and School Social Workers SOC 21-1021.00 | 3 | $51,022 |
| Special Education Teachers, All Other SOC 25-2059.00 | 1 | $58,720 |
| Mental Health Counselors SOC 21-1014.00 | 1 | $61,734 |

Green-card (PERM) sponsorship at The Devereux Foundation
PERM (Permanent Employment Certification) is the DOL step required before an employer can sponsor a foreign worker for an EB-2 or EB-3 employment-based green card. Companies that file PERM are committing to long-term immigrant employment, not just temporary H-1B work.

What's the difference between an LCA and a granted H-1B?
An LCA (Labor Condition Application) is the first step — the employer attests to the Department of Labor that they'll pay the prevailing wage and meet other conditions. After DOL certifies the LCA, the employer files the actual I-129 H-1B petition with USCIS. LCA volume is the best public signal of an employer's H-1B sponsorship activity.
